World system theory is a macrosociological perspective that seeks to explain the dynamics of the “capitalist world economy” as a “total social system”. Originally combining insights from dependency and annales schools, world systems theory is an analytical framework emerging in the late 1960s to explain long term, multiple scale social dynamics. The world system analysis reflects on mini systems as characteristics of past, a bygone era and focus on world systems as operative units of social reality whose rules have constraining effect on individuals and society. Key takeaways wallerstein's world system theory critiques modernization theory's linear development stages, asserting uneven global development. core periphery dynamics dictate economic relationships, with core states exploiting peripheral resources for growth. World systems theory offers a model of human interaction that crosscuts economic, political, and social dimensions.
